    (dumb?) newbie help required for Live.

    I'm sure there was a topic here that used to be sticky about this sort of thing, but its sticky no more and I can't find what I'm after with either the local search or with Google, so please go easy on me.

    I've got an unmodded PAL Xbox, a PC running XP Home, a 4 port 10Mbit hub and an indication from BT that I should be able to get ASDL at home, though I'm only on dialup currently. My ISP is Clara, and I've no intention of changing, so it'll be them doing the broadband supply, if that matters (in case it does, they do dynamic IPs rather than static ones, unless you fork over extra).

    Basically, what I need to know is what I need to get. The obvious expenditures are these:

    Upgrade of phone to BB
    Microfilter
    More expensive ISP charges
    Live kit
    ASDL modem of some kind

    Am I missing anything else? Is it worth building a seperate firewall? Does anyone have a particular modem to recommend?

    I could have sworn I'd seen a reasonably priced router with built in firewall, but I can't find it now.
